Sat 743068352026146

decimal
148613.3352026146
degree
0°148613′1445″3352026146‴
percentile
35.38420727826293%
name
iowvqumolfz
cycle
0
epoch
0
period
73
block
148613
offset
3352026146
timestamp
rarity
common